from pathlib import Path
from setuptools import setup # pyright: reportMissingTypeStubs=false
from asking import __version__
readme_path = Path(__file__).parent / "README.md"
with open(readme_path, encoding="utf-8") as f:
long_description = f.read()
classifiers = [
"License :: OSI Approved :: MIT License",
"Natural Language :: English",
"Operating System :: OS Independent",
"Programming Language :: Python :: 3 :: Only",
"Programming Language :: Python :: 3.8",
"Programming Language :: Python :: 3.9",
"Programming Language :: Python :: 3.10",
"Typing :: Typed",
]
if "a" in __version__:
classifiers.append("Development Status :: 3 - Alpha")
elif "b" in __version__:
classifiers.append("Development Status :: 4 - Beta")
else:
classifiers.append("Development Status :: 5 - Production/Stable")
classifiers.sort()
setup(
author="Cariad Eccleston",
author_email="[email protected]",
classifiers=classifiers,
description="Asking questions and getting answers",
entry_points={
"console_scripts": [
"asking=asking.__main__:entry",
],
},
include_package_data=True,
install_requires=[
"ansiscape~=1.1.2",
"ansiwrap~=0.8",
"cline~=1.1",
"pyyaml~=6.0",
],
license="MIT",
long_description=long_description,
long_description_content_type="text/markdown",
name="asking",
packages=[
"asking",
"asking.actions",
"asking.loaders",
"asking.models",
"asking.prompts",
"asking.protocols",
"asking.tasks",
],
package_data={
"asking": ["py.typed"],
"asking.actions": ["py.typed"],
"asking.loaders": ["py.typed"],
"asking.models": ["py.typed"],
"asking.prompts": ["py.typed"],
"asking.protocols": ["py.typed"],
"asking.tasks": ["py.typed"],
},
python_requires=">=3.8",
url="https://github.com/cariad/asking",
version=__version__,
)
